Abstract
This thesis proposes a heuristic for solving multi-type component assignment problems (CAP) to maximize the whole system reliability. Birnbaum importance (BI) is applied in this thesis to measure the importance of positions in a system. By comparing BI values for each type position, the most importance position can be determined. When the larger the BI value, the more important the related positions is. The most important position is assigned the right type component with the largest reliability. Both small and large systems are used to illustrate the performance and effectiveness of the proposal heuristic method. The results show the accuracy and computational efficiency of the proposed method, compared to other methods, including mathematical programming, enumeration, and randomization.
